Exploring the Gameplay Mechanics of King’s Knight
King’s Knight is a classic action-RPG that first graced the Nintendo Entertainment System in 1986. The game stands out for its unique blend of vertical scrolling and side-scrolling mechanics, allowing players to control four distinct characters—Cecil, the knight; Pochi, the dog; and two magical sisters. Each character possesses unique abilities, adding layers of strategy to the gameplay. The challenge lies in navigating through different levels filled with enemies and obstacles, often requiring precise timing and skillful movements.
The difficulty of King’s Knight is notable, as players face a limited number of continues and must master each character’s strengths and weaknesses to advance through the game. The interplay between characters encourages cooperative play, making it a precursor to later multiplayer experiences. Players must also collect power-ups and defeat bosses, which enhance the game’s replayability and keep players coming back for more.
A Historical Perspective on King’s Knight
Released by Square (now Square Enix), King’s Knight was part of a wave of innovative titles emerging from Japan during the mid-1980s. This was a period marked by rapid advancements in video game technology, and King’s Knight capitalized on the NES hardware capabilities, showcasing impressive graphics and sound for its time. As a product of its era, the game reflects the growing trend of narrative-driven experiences in gaming, setting the stage for future RPGs.
Despite being overshadowed by more popular titles, King’s Knight has maintained its charm among retro gaming enthusiasts. Its release was part of a broader cultural phenomenon in Japan, where gaming began to permeate various aspects of society. The game’s characters and storylines have woven themselves into the tapestry of gaming history, influencing subsequent titles with similar mechanics.
